Biography
Dr Louise Ludlow established and manages the Children's Cancer Centre Tissue Bank which is an essential research enabling platform. The CCC Tissue Bank, established in April 2014 with funding and support from the Cancer in Kids Auxiliary (CIKA), is one of only three paediatric tissue banks in Australia and comprises a collection of tissue that has been preserved for future clinical investigation and ethically approved research. The Tissue Bank is integral to our efforts to improve diagnostics and develop better “personalised" treatments for children diagnosed with cancer in the future. Dr Ludlow has extensive experience in cell and molecular biology completing her PhD in cancer research under the supervision of Prof Ricky Johnstone at the Peter MacCallum Cancer Centre. Louise's first postdoctoral position was undertaken in Prof Curt Horvath's Laboratory at Northwestern University, Evanston IL followed by a four year collaborative Research Officer position at The University of Melbourne and the Burnet Institute.
